Learning and Behavior Disorders: A Longitudinal Study.
In a survey of school learning and behavior problems manifested in a longitudinal study population. of 967 children in kindergarten through third grade, it was found that 41 percent of the subjects (50 percent of the boys and 31 percent of the girls) were classified in one or more of the following c...
